Description

Description

The Birch is a characterful 100-cover pub and restaurant that has been trading successfully since the mid-19th Century.

The property exudes charm and character with an exterior that complements the surrounding area. The pub is well-maintained and features a welcoming atmosphere that attracts both locals and visitors alike.

The focus on high-quality food and exceptional service has earned The Birch a stellar reputation in the community.

Location

The Birch is situated on the outskirts of the prestigious ancient market town of Woburn in Buckinghamshire.

This affluent area is renowned for its picturesque landscapes, historic architecture, and vibrant community. The pub is conveniently located just a short drive from Milton Keynes, providing easy access to a larger urban population while maintaining the charm and tranquillity of a countryside setting.

Internal Details

Inside, The Birch boasts a spacious and tastefully decorated dining area that can comfortably accommodate up to 100 guests within the bar and restaurant areas.

The interior design blends traditional elements with modern comforts creating a warm and inviting ambiance. The pub features a well-equipped kitchen, a light and welcoming restaurant area, and a cosy front bar for patrons to relax and enjoy their meals.

The attention to detail in the décor and layout ensures a pleasant dining experience for all guests.

External Details

Externally, The Birch features ample parking facilities, ensuring convenience for guests arriving by car.

The property also includes a charming trade terrace, perfect for al fresco dining during the warmer months. The well-maintained garden area adds to the overall appeal providing a picturesque setting for outdoor events and gatherings.

There is also a brick-built barn to the rear of the property that could be converted to letting accommodation (STPP)

Owner's Accommodation

The property includes well-appointed owner's accommodation which provides a comfortable living space for the new proprietors. The accommodation features three bedrooms, a kitchen, and a living area which offers a perfect blend of convenience and privacy. This setup allows the owners to live on-site or provide accommodation for several staff members.

Trading Information

The business has a net turnover of c. £850k per annum on a 4.5 day trading week allowing room for growth should a new owner wish to increase opening hours.
